MURRAY DALTON Executors for the estate of the late Mrs. Edna Oswald HAROLD STADE, Clerk ALVIN WALPER, Auctioneer 24c NPT ..,E LOST OAVE.I., AND STAND- A few weeks ago the Gavel and Stand presented by the City of Exeter, England, to this town disappeared from the Council Chambers. While the cash value of these articles is small, they are greatly valued by the Town Council and the citizens of Exeter. The Town Council asks that these articles he returned to the Clerk's Office or the Town Hall, No questions will be asked, Any information in re- gard to the whereabouts of the Gavel and Stand will be great- 1Y appreciated, Dated May 16, 1962. C. V. PICKARD, Town Clerk, Town of Exeter. 17:24c TglaIDERS. FOR cA$91,.iNg.
